/* Node type: File.
*
* Author: Steffen Vogel <post@steffenvogel.de>
* SPDX-FileCopyrightText: 2014-2023 Institute for Automation of Complex Power Systems, RWTH Aachen University
* S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0
*/
#pragma once
#include <cstddef>
#include <cstdio>
#include <map>
#include <string>
#include <vector>
#include <villas/format.hpp>
#include <villas/task.hpp>
namespace villas {
namespace node {
// Forward declarations
class NodeCompat;
#define FILE_MAX_PATHLEN 512
struct file {
Format *formatter;
FILE *stream_in;
FILE *stream_out;
char *uri_tmpl; // Format string for file name.
char *uri; // Real file name.
unsigned skip_lines; // Skip the first n-th lines/samples of the file.
int flush; // Flush / upload file contents after each write.
struct Task
task; // Timer file descriptor. Blocks until 1 / rate seconds are elapsed.
double rate; // The read rate.
size_t
buffer_size_out; // Defines size of output stream buffer. No buffer is created if value is set to zero.
size_t
buffer_size_in; // Defines size of input stream buffer. No buffer is created if value is set to zero.
enum class EpochMode {
DIRECT,
WAIT,
RELATIVE,
ABSOLUTE,
ORIGINAL
} epoch_mode; // Specifies how file::offset is calculated.
enum class EOFBehaviour {
STOP, // Terminate when EOF is reached.
REWIND, // Rewind the file when EOF is reached.
SUSPEND // Blocking wait when EOF is reached.
} eof_mode;
struct timespec
first; // The first timestamp in the file file::{read,write}::uri
struct timespec epoch; // The epoch timestamp from the configuration.
struct timespec
offset; // An offset between the timestamp in the input file and the current time
std::vector<Sample *> samples;
size_t read_pos;
enum class ReadMode { RATE_BASED, READ_ALL } read_mode;
bool read;
// For multi-file support
std::vector<std::string> uri_templates;
std::vector<std::string> uris;
std::map<std::string, std::vector<Sample *>>
file_samples; // Map: filename --> filesamples
std::map<std::string, size_t>
file_read_pos; // Map: filename --> current read position in file
bool multi_file_mode;
size_t
total_files_size; //To calculate the total number of lines to be read across multiple files
};
char *file_print(NodeCompat *n);
int file_parse(NodeCompat *n, json_t *json);
int file_start(NodeCompat *n);
int file_stop(NodeCompat *n);
int file_init(NodeCompat *n);
int file_destroy(NodeCompat *n);
int file_poll_fds(NodeCompat *n, int fds[]);
int file_read(NodeCompat *n, struct Sample *const smps[], unsigned cnt);
int file_write(NodeCompat *n, struct Sample *const smps[], unsigned cnt);
} // namespace node
} // namespace villas
